Firstly, familiarize yourself with the role of miners in securing the Bitcoin network. They utilize powerful processors to solve intricate cryptographic puzzles, validating transactions and adding new blocks to the blockchain. This process is computationally intensive, demanding significant energy consumption.
Next, consider the diverse range of mining methods. From solo mining to joining a pool, each method presents its own set of advantages and challenges. Thoroughly research different hardware options available, as their performance directly impacts your mining profitability.

Diving into the world of copyright, we encounter a fundamental process known as mining. This complex operation demands specialized hardware to verify transactions on a network, essentially securing the integrity of the system. Miners compete against each other to decipher intricate mathematical problems, with the successful miner incentivized with newly minted coins. From the OG Bitcoin (BTC) to the meme-fueled Dogecoin (DOGE), every digital asset has its own mining protocol, requiring different hardware setups and methods.
- BTC mining relies on a process called PoW, requiring massive computational power to solve complex cryptographic puzzles.
- DOGE, known for its simplicity, utilizes a similar PoW algorithm but is less computationally intensive.
